Linux系统优化指南:哪些设置可以提升系统性能

时间:2025-12-06 分类:操作系统

Linux系统凭借其高效性和灵活性,广泛应用于服务器、桌面及嵌入式设备。尽管Linux系统本身已经相当成熟,但仍有许多方法可以优化其性能,以满足不同用户的需求。本文将详细介绍如何通过一些简单的设置和调整,提升Linux系统的整体性能。无论是系统启动速度、应用运行效率,还是资源管理,本文都将为您提供实用的优化建议,帮助您在使用Linux时获得更流畅的体验。

Linux系统优化指南:哪些设置可以提升系统性能

定期更新系统是保持Linux运行流畅的重要措施。Linux社区会不断推出更新,以修复bug和提升性能。通过命令行执行如`sudo apt update && sudo apt upgrade`的指令,可以确保您使用的是最新版本的软件包及内核。这不仅可以提升性能,还可以增强系统安全性。

合理配置交换空间(swap)也是提升系统性能的关键。交换空间可以在物理内存不足时为系统提供额外的内存支持。您可以通过调整`swappiness`参数来优化交换空间的使用,通常情况下,建议设置为10-20,以避免频繁使用交换空间,进而提高性能。

接下来,文件系统底层的调优也不可忽视。选择合适的文件系统(如Ext4、XFS等)可影响读写速度。使用`noatime`选项来挂载文件系统,可以减少不必要的磁盘I/O操作,进一步提升系统响应速度。

对于服务器用户,合理配置服务和进程是优化性能的另一重要环节。可以使用`systemctl`命令来禁用不必要的服务,减少系统资源的占用。使用`nice`和`ionice`命令调整进程优先级,可以确保关键任务获得足够的CPU和I/O资源,从而提高整体系统性能。

网络优化也能显著提升Linux系统的使用体验。通过修改`/etc/sysctl.conf`文件,可以调整TCP缓冲区大小、开启TCP快速打开等功能,这些设置能够提升网络传输效率,特别对于需要频繁进行网络交互的应用尤为重要。

定期清理系统和监控资源使用情况也是必不可少的。使用工具如`htop`、`iotop`等,可以实时监控系统性能,及时发现问题。这些措施结合系统的具体使用场景,可以有效提升Linux系统的整体性能,帮助用户实现更高效的操作环境。

通过上述设置和调整,您可以显著提升Linux系统的性能,享受更流畅的使用体验。只要保持对系统的关注和对优化措施的定期实施,就能让您的Linux系统始终保持高效和安全。